About The Position

The Test Engineer will establish test procedures and coordinate testing of products under development or in production Essential Duties and Responsibilities include the following. Other Duties not listed may be assigned. Duties/Responsibilities: Coordinates and performs tests at the quality control stage of the manufacturing process. Gathers and studies information regarding materials and components to be used in production. Drafts proposals for testing programs and operating procedures; outlines the specific testing conditions to be applied. Tests new products; develops systems to gather digital data during testing. Studies the data gathered during testing and evaluates the validity of the results. Identifies any problems with new products; makes adjustments or recommendations to resolve problems. Continues testing and analysis until results are within product requirements and specifications. Drafts detailed technical reports to present findings; based on findings, recommends modifications needed to correct production problems. Develops ongoing quality control testing procedures to be incorporate into the regular production process. Performs other related duties as required. Find Innovative methods to save time and Money while maintaining the effectiveness of the quality.
